Trauma exposure and the subsequent risk of coronary heart disease among mid-aged women

Based on data from the Australian Longitudinal Study on Women’s Health, the authors found that women who reported trauma exposure at baseline were 1.54 times more likely to report new onset of coronary heart disease than those who did
not report trauma exposure.
